Cranscombe Barn is a beautifully renovated barn conversion situated in a quiet location in the Exmoor National Park. Sleeping four people, the character cottage has beamed ceilings, thick walls with deep sill window seats and latched doors which are complemented by modern, contemporary furniture. External stairs lead up to the open-plan lounge/kitchen/diner which has stunning views over the surrounding countryside. This cosy room has a woodburner in the original fireplace, a high apex ceiling with exposed cross beams and a wooden floor. The kitchen area is well laid out and a circular dining table provides a natural divide between the lounge and kitchen. Downstairs, both of the bedrooms are beautifully furnished and share the use of a large, modern bathroom with a bath and separate walk-in shower. Outside, the cottage has a decked area with garden furniture and a rough, sloping grassy area to the side, There are many pathways and bridleways surrounding Cranscombe Barn including a private right of way to open moorland and a footpath leading from the cottage to the riverside pub in Rockford. There are also riverside walks towards Watersmeet and Lynmouth. The village of Brendon, scattered along the East Lyn valley, is just a couple of miles away. A path from Brendon will take you to Lynmouth via the famous beauty spot of Watersmeet,  Some of the country’s most dramatic cliffs can be found nearby and the surfing beaches of Woolacombe and Croyde are within an hour’s drive.
